The Pros:Provides a wide swath of caloric/exercise data in graphical form for analysis. Automatically produces graphs after syncing with web application. Very easy to determine if personal exercise goals are being met.
The Cons:Fairly expensive for the initial device purchase, with rather expensive monthly subscription fee. Web application is complex and some users may find it frustrating to navigate menus. Performance is optimal when detailed diet information is included, which can be too time consuming for some.
The KiFit is an armband device that is designed to monitor your body round the clock, keeping track of calories burned, physical activity and your sleep habits, amongst other things. The KiFit also has a web management system, for a monthly subscription, where you can keep track of all your statistics and goals.

The KiFit armband multi-monitor is a fitness tool which allows someone to have access to detailed information regarding their health statistics. These include keeping track of the number of calories burned during any point in the day, and during your sleep, calorie intake, physical activity, total steps taken and sleep time/efficiency. The KiFit seeks to fill a gap in the market by providing a more detailed analysis of the bodies statistics throughout a day than more targeted health monitors, such as a pedometer or heart rate monitor. This approach is highlighted by the KiFit web management system online where you can view an overall picture of your gathered statistics. The KiFit can also be bought with an optional display for real time readings.
